Harbingers of spring, storks arrive early in Erzincan

Storks, the harbingers of spring, have arrived early in Erzincan, where temperatures have been above seasonal norms.

In Erzincan, where the weather has been warmer than seasonal norms, winter was practically non-existent. Storks, known as the harbingers of spring and seemingly confused by climate change, have arrived early in Erzincan.

The arrival of the storks, which were expected at the beginning of April, towards the end of March surprised those who saw them.

The storks, which have been returning to the same spot for about 50 years from generation to generation, were photographed in a village in the Kemah district of Erzincan.

Village resident Musa Taştan stated that the storks arrived early, saying, "There are all kinds of birds in this region, such as wild ducks, partridges, storks, starlings, and sparrows. The storks arrived a bit early this year. Even the crocuses in the mountains bloomed early. As long as I can remember, they have come here every year."
Taştan noted that the storks have been coming for 50 years, adding, "They used to come to a poplar tree, now they come to this utility pole. Since I was born, a pair of storks has always come. They have 5-6 chicks. When autumn comes, they leave here. Sometimes it happens that it snows, and they stay through the storms and cold," he said.
